As part of its children’s product offering, Emirates’ has specially designed gear in bright colours; purple, green and yellow, which is applied to cutlery, tray mats, snack boxes, headset bags, as well as the toy bags. Emirates catering team designed menus for kids that appeal to Emirates’ multi-national passengers, allowing children to enjoy both variety and their favourite dishes.
Young passengers are provided with a fun pack containing the new monster-themed toys. Aimed at pre-school children, the monster collection truly embodies the spirit of young globalistas with quirky names from across the globe. They come in two categories; Blanket Buddies – plush characters wrapped around soft polar fleece blankets, and Seat Belt Critters – little toys worn around a seat belt to encourage safety. Young travellers can also enjoy the existing range of children’s products including the 321/e-kids magazine, coloured pencils, branded Emirates rucksacks and cooler bags, children’s eyeshades and the popular Dr. Seuss books.
Older children can enjoy the Quiksilver collection of travel-inspired products co-designed with iconic lifestyle brand Quiksilver, on long-haul flights over five hours.
In addition, special services for children and infants are provided. They include; priority boarding for families with small children, special fares for children aged two to 11, 10kg free baggage allowance for infants not occupying a seat, special brightly-coloured child-sized headsets to ensure a snug fit, baby kits, bassinets, nappies and baby change tables. Baby bottles, milk formula and two types of jar food as well as food/bottle heating services are available. Upon arrival in Dubai, special ‘stroller’ delivery service for parents with small babies is provided, enabling them access to pushchairs immediately upon disembarking the aircraft.
